What is the Notice of Filing of Foreign Judgment?
The Notice of Filing of Foreign Judgment is a critical legal document used under the Uniform Enforcement of Foreign Judgment Act in Colorado. This form plays a vital role in alerting the judgment debtor that a judgment against them has been filed in a Colorado court. Key terms such as "judgment creditor," who seeks to enforce the judgment, and "judgment debtor," against whom the judgment is enforced, are essential for understanding this document. This notice is important for enforcing judgments already rendered in other jurisdictions, providing a formal mechanism for creditors to pursue owed amounts.

Who Needs the Notice of Filing of Foreign Judgment?
The primary users of this form include judgment creditors, who are the individuals or entities pursuing the owed amounts, as well as their attorneys, who facilitate the legal processes. Clerks or deputy clerks also play a role in managing the filing and processing of this notice. Each of these parties may have different circumstances under which they would file the notice, ensuring that all legal requirements are met in the enforcement of foreign judgments.
